Among the most fascinating sites is perhaps the ethereal remains of Silver City, famously known for its silver rush. Founded in the 1860s, its hauntingly beautiful architecture has captivated those who stumble upon its quiet streets. The town’s relics stand still, echoing tales of its vibrant past.
